Output 131faa30143a53b8f16472d79ec18b9e027562d0a9e476ca59172a6acec7cb13:0

value
2240522
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 138f8bc48c07c42986a76f12732d4cbf8cbb6e1b OP_EQUALVERIFY OP_CHECKSIG
address
12nRoPpeRUqiCR4v4Q3H3EvmqTERwVogxA
transaction
131faa30143a53b8f16472d79ec18b9e027562d0a9e476ca59172a6acec7cb13
spent
true